What worked for me when I quit, I was drinking 4 cups every day. And yes, I've tried quitting cold turkey! But I found that by reducing my coffee intake by 1/2 cup a week would eliminate the headaches, and by the time I was down to a cup, I just quit. Sure it takes several weeks to do this, but unless you are a fan of caffeine withdrawals, this is recommended to ease you into your goal.
